Abstract

Guidance and counseling services in early childhood education play an important role in supporting children’s social, emotional, behavioral, and self-adjustment development. However, the implementation of guidance and counseling services at the kindergarten level still faces several challenges, including the absence of professional counselors, limited teacher understanding regarding guidance and counseling services, and the lack of structured counseling programs. In addition, studies concerning the implementation of guidance and counseling services in local contexts, particularly in kindergartens in Samarinda, remain limited, as previous studies have primarily focused on conceptual discussions and program development. This condition indicates a research gap related to the actual implementation of guidance and counseling services for early childhood education in kindergarten settings. This study aimed to describe the implementation of guidance and counseling services for early childhood children in kindergartens in Samarinda City. The study employed a qualitative approach with a descriptive research design. The research subjects consisted of kindergarten principals and teachers selected using purposive sampling techniques. Data were collected through observations, interviews, and documentation, while data analysis was conducted using the Miles, Huberman, and Saldaña model, including data reduction, data display, and conclusion drawing. The findings revealed that the implementation of guidance and counseling services for early childhood children in kindergartens in Samarinda City had been integrated into learning activities and daily habituation programs. The services implemented included orientation services, information services, social and emotional development assistance, simple individual counseling, and collaboration with parents. Teachers served as facilitators, mentors, developmental observers, mediators, and liaisons between schools and parents. Nevertheless, the implementation still encountered several obstacles, such as limited teacher competencies, the absence of structured guidance and counseling programs, and the lack of professional counselors. This study concludes that guidance and counseling services in kindergartens in Samarinda City have been implemented through preventive and developmental approaches; however, their implementation still requires strengthening through the development of structured counseling programs and the enhancement of teacher competencies to optimize service delivery
